## Formula sandbox tuning

User-supplied formulas in Gridmoor execute inside a restricted interpreter with hard ceilings on time, memory, and call depth. Reviewers should confirm any change to these ceilings is justified in the PR description, since raising them widens the abuse surface. Defaults were chosen from production traces. The current limits are as follows.

limits module of tafog-fawip:
WEIGHTS = {
    "julix": 57,
    "lamys": 992,
    "kasvan": 209,
    "quenok": 750,
    "alddor": 259,
    "oliath": 1009,
    "wenix": 815,
}

We are introducing Halcyard Plus, a mid-range subscription tier positioned between Basic and Enterprise. It adds priority scheduling, extended reporting, and two seats of the Fennet analytics add-on. Pricing lands roughly 40% above Basic. Pilot branches in Ostermile and Carraway showed solid uptake with minimal downgrade pressure. Branch managers should prepare staff talking points before the regional rollout. Further strategic context, marked confidential, is set out immediately below this briefing.

board note of kageg-bahof: The renewal with Holwynax Holdings closes at $2 million a year, 5 percent below the last contract. Project Ulaath slips by two quarters because of the supplier delay.

First-Day Checklist — Contractor Shuttle Access

☐ Board the Kestrel Row shuttle at Stop B, not Stop A.
☐ Show your contractor pass to the driver.
☐ At the campus shuttle gate, sign the visitor sheet in the kiosk.
☐ The pedestrian side-gate needs a keypad entry; to open it, use the code below.

turnstile pass: bdg-FVNQRS-72965873